About the Chef role

Explore a world of culinary creativity and career growth with Chef jobs. A Chef is far more than just a cook; they are the creative and operational mastermind behind the food we enjoy. This profession blends artistic passion with scientific precision, business acumen, and leadership, offering a dynamic and rewarding career path for those with a love for gastronomy. From bustling hotel kitchens to intimate fine-dining establishments, Chef jobs are the backbone of the food service industry, responsible for transforming raw ingredients into memorable dining experiences.

The role of a Chef is typically structured within a kitchen hierarchy known as the brigade de cuisine. This system defines clear responsibilities, from the Executive Chef overseeing the entire kitchen operation to specialized roles like the Sous Chef, Chef de Partie (station chef), and Commis Chef (junior chef). Common responsibilities across these roles include menu planning and development, recipe creation, and meticulous food preparation. Chefs are tasked with ensuring every dish meets rigorous standards for taste, quality, and visual presentation. They manage kitchen inventory, order supplies, and control food costs to maintain budgetary goals. A significant part of the job involves supervising and training kitchen staff, fostering a collaborative and efficient team environment. Furthermore, Chefs are paramount in enforcing strict health, safety, and sanitation protocols to ensure a safe workspace and compliant kitchen.

To succeed in Chef jobs, a specific set of skills and attributes is essential. Culinary expertise is, of course, fundamental, including mastery of various cooking techniques, knife skills, and a deep understanding of flavors, ingredients, and food pairings. However, technical skill alone is not enough. The best Chefs possess exceptional leadership and communication abilities to guide their team through high-pressure service periods. Organizational skills and the capacity to multitask are crucial for managing multiple orders and components simultaneously. Creativity and a passion for innovation drive menu development and keep a restaurant competitive. Physical stamina is also a key requirement, as the role involves long hours standing in a hot, fast-paced environment. While many professionals hold degrees from culinary schools, numerous Chef jobs are secured through years of dedicated hands-on experience, often starting in entry-level positions and advancing through the ranks.
